Houtu Dependencies
houtu-dependencies enterprise-grade Spring Cloud microservice foundational framework complete usage guide. GroupId is io.github.lujiafa, covering unified response, exception handling, parameter parsing, session authentication, permission control, signature verification, anti-replay, distributed lock, rate limiting, database field encryption, config decryption, access logging, canary routing, weighted load balancing, Feign enhancement, Sentinel circuit breaking, service discovery, Swagger documentation, crypto utilities, HTTP client, monitoring metrics, and other enterprise-grade capabilities. When the project build file (pom.xml or build.gradle/build.gradle.kts) contains io.github.lujiafa or houtu-related dependencies, or when the user mentions houtu or houtu-dependencies, this Skill must be read and code must be generated strictly following framework conventions. Even if the user is simply doing regular Spring Boot development (e.g., writing Controller, Service, Feign), as long as the project includes houtu, the houtu approach must be used instead of native Spring. When the user explicitly wants to use the houtu framework and the project has not yet included it, proactively add the BOM and required Starters; when the project already includes it, proactively identify and import required module dependencies based on business scenarios during coding, naturally integrating framework capabilities to enhance business services based on business semantics, rather than waiting for the user to specify each one.
What this skill does
Houtu Dependencies is a community-contributed Claude Code skill in the security-misc sub-category. It ships as a SKILL.md file that Claude Code auto-discovers under ~/.claude/skills/houtu-dependencies/ and loads when your prompt matches the skill's trigger.
Who uses this skill
The Houtu Dependencies skill is built for security engineers, penetration testers, DevSecOps practitioners, and development teams hardening codebases and infrastructure. It is part of the open ClaudSkills registry, a community-curated catalog of 56,000+ capabilities you can install for Claude Code — the Claude CLI agent.
How to install
Free
Manual install (2 steps)
mkdir -p ~/.claude/skills/houtu-dependencies
curl -L https://claudskills.com/skills/houtu-dependencies/SKILL.md \
-o ~/.claude/skills/houtu-dependencies/SKILL.md
Or just download SKILL.md directly and drop it into ~/.claude/skills/houtu-dependencies/. Claude Code auto-discovers it on next session.
Skills live at ~/.claude/skills/houtu-dependencies/SKILL.md on macOS/Linux, or %USERPROFILE%\.claude\skills\houtu-dependencies\SKILL.md on Windows. See the full install guide for step-by-step instructions.
Pro
One-click install via the desktop app
The ClaudSkills desktop app installs any skill directly into ~/.claude/skills/ with one click — no terminal required. Pro starts at $9/mo or $149 lifetime.
Pro
For the full experience including quality scoring and one-click install features for each skill — upgrade to Pro.
More Security skills
Browse all Security skills in the ClaudSkills registry, or explore these other picks from the same category:
Part of Acreator Store — Adam Lankamer's AI tools:
GifPerfect ·
AspectPerfect ·
SlomoPerfect ·
Ucaption ·
UTagger ·
AutoXPoster ·
TestYourSkills